Información general del proyecto

Title IoT Based Domestic Metering Device Problem Statement The assembled kilowatt-hour meter by electrical energy providers will only show the electrical consumption in terms of kWh rather than showing the cost of energy that we have spent. In order to check the unit's consumption, the consumer has to go to check the meter physically but if the device display the consumed units and pricing information on the mobile application then it might function accordingly. Keeping these requirements in mind we propose a project to show the electrical consumption pricing in real-time. Abstract The project focuses on the design and creation of a device with a mobile application for the electricity consumer. This device will make it very easier for a customer to monitor home/office appliances Watts(W), Ampere(A), Voltage(V), units consumed (KWh), the running duration & Bill Amount (Cost) in real-time. The design will involve communication between a PIC microcontroller and the mobile application. It is a device that can be accessed anywhere by using a mobile application as compared to other smart meters. These devices will be implemented at single phase supply areas like homes, offices, shops and submeters. Real-time pricing will give a real cost-controlling opportunity to consumers and to plan and manage their electrical consumption effectively. Objective The main objectives of this lab are:  To design and creation of device as well as mobile application for the electricity consumers  Acquisition of real-time data from sensors that can be used by mobile app (voltage & current)  To design a mobile app that can record the real-time data of the user  To design a hardware that can fetch the data from the user end  To design a mobile app that can generate expected electricity bill on the basis of unit consumption  To design a mobile app that provides 24/7 online monitoring of the data Outcomes Studies shows that users prefer mobile apps more that mobile websites that’s why this idea introduces mobile app for electrical data metering.  Mobile app is main outcome which linked with the device that have several features for public  Mobile app monitors real time data of energy meter with better personalization  Mobile app is also incorporate with expected cost of electricity and units  Due to better operational efficiency user can get 24/7 online monitoring of unit consumption and expected bill at any time in the whole month on app  Providing real time data useful for balancing electrical load (Load Management) and reducing power outages  This mobile app also stores the data and user friendly  Real-time pricing will give a real cost-controlling opportunity to consumers and to plan and manage their electrical consumption effectively.
